Output 28be858b0c1bb42e092cf18a74f89b89d39dda7949a2ba8bee2ecfa3274e68d7:0

value
6564536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4d2315b69527d0f6aaffef3153bf2985fb18aca OP_EQUAL
address
3JB7MXQdMCcT2K3bcTQmGEG2Ec6E9M5vUZ
transaction
28be858b0c1bb42e092cf18a74f89b89d39dda7949a2ba8bee2ecfa3274e68d7
confirmations
503359
spent
true